  • What are the signs that a property may have been used as a meth lab?

    Indicators that a property may have been used as a meth lab include unusual odors (resembling ammonia or cat urine), stained surfaces, covered or blacked-out windows, excessive security measures, and the presence of chemical containers or laboratory equipment.

  • What are the most common causes of hoarding?

    Hoarding can be caused by a variety of psychological, emotional, and environmental factors. Common causes include anxiety disorders, depression, past trauma, and ob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D). Some individuals develop hoarding tendencies as a coping mechanism for loss or emotional distress. Others may have difficulty making decisions, leading to an accumulation of possessions. Genetic and environmental influences can also play a role, as hoarding behavior may be learned from family members.   • How can tear gas residue affect HVAC systems?

    Tear gas particles can infiltrate HVAC systems, spreading contaminants throughout the building. Professional cleanup includes thorough cleaning of ductwork and ventilation systems to prevent further contamination.
